We Are Too Blessed To Be Poor – President Akufo-Addo On Africa’s Resources Development

Addressing the second edition of the Africa Prosperity Dialogues in Peduase, Eastern region, on Thursday, January 25, 2024, President Akufo-Addo underscored that Africa, with its wealth of natural resources, should never grapple with poverty.

Highlighting the continent’s vast resources such as oil, gas, minerals, abundant sunlight, and 65% of arable land capable of feeding 9 billion people globally by 2030, the President expressed his vision for Africa to evolve into a global powerhouse.

Encouraged by a proactive private sector and the potential economic collaboration facilitated by the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A), President Akufo-Addo emphasized the crucial role of economic integration.

He emphasized the ongoing efforts to promote the free movement of people, goods, and services across the continent as vital for realizing the dream of a united Africa.

President Akufo-Addo stated, “We all know that Africa is blessed, Africa is not a poor continent, in fact, she is too rich to be poor. A continent that has every natural resource imaginable; oil, gas, minerals and an abundance of sunlight. We have some 65 percent of all arable land available to feed 9 billion people globally by 2030 and our continent is filled with the most youthful population in the world –everything we need to transform Africa into a global powerhouse of the future.”

He further expressed his optimism about the readiness of the African private sector to contribute to the realization of the United Africa dream.

The President concluded by emphasizing the need to focus on economic integration, particularly in facilitating the free movement of people, goods, and services across the continent.
